+ | [[Beck]] intercepts a [[Power upgrade weapon|secret weapon]] that gives any [[program]] who wears it increased strength and agility, but also makes the program more aggressive and reckless. [[Tron]] orders Beck to destroy the power-mod, but Beck secretly defies Tron and keeps the weapon for himself. After Beck, wearing the power-mod, brazenly attacks [[General Tessler]] in his own base, everyone at the garage is put in danger when the Occupation decides to take programs captive to force The Renegade's hand. |
